I hereby pledge to provide positive support, care, and encouragement for my child participating in youth sports by following this Parents’ Code of Ethics:
I will encourage good sportsmanship by demonstrating positive support for all players, coaches, and officials at every game, practice or other HDYB events.
I will place the emotional and physical well being of my child ahead of my personal desire to win.
I will support coaches and officials working with my child, in order to encourage a positive and enjoyable experience for all.
I will refrain from the use of tobacco and alcohol and will refrain from their use at all youth sports events.
I will remember that the game is for youth - not adults. I will do my very best to make youth sports fun for my child.
I will ask my child to treat other players, coaches, fans and officials with respect regardless of race, sex, creed or ability.
I will help my child enjoy the youth sports experience by doing whatever I can, such as being a respectful fan, assisting with coaching, or providing transportation.
At HDYB, the Baseball Committee will take a no tolerance approach to the above. If an umpire or a HDYB official throws you out of a game you must leave the ballpark immediately. You will be suspended from the ballpark for a time to be determined by the baseball committee. Depending on the severity of the offense this may result in suspension for the remainder of the season.
